Public Safety Officer I - Armed (Full Time, N. Western Ave.)

Join to apply for the Public Safety Officer I - Armed (Full Time, N. Western Ave.) role at Advocate Health.

Position Details
  • Location: 4025 N. Western Ave., Chicago, IL
  • Schedule: Full Time; Monday-Friday, with possible weekend coverage. Specific hours to be discussed during the interview.
Major Responsibilities
  • Provide professional, fair, and compassionate security services, maintaining a professional appearance and demeanor.
  • Conduct interior and exterior patrols, inspections, and audits to ensure safety and security.
  • Respond to and investigate workplace violence, service calls, and emergencies, including de-escalation and physical intervention if necessary.
  • Investigate incidents, complete reports, and coordinate with law enforcement and first responders.
  • Perform security awareness education and liaison duties within departments.
  • Maintain training standards, including radio communications, de-escalation, CPR, restraints, and Taser use.
Qualifications
  • High School Diploma or GED.
  • 1 year of experience in security, public safety, or customer service responding to emergent situations.
  • Valid driver’s license, FOID card or CCW license, and Security Officer Healthcare Certification (CHSO).
  • Ability to carry a firearm, pass background checks, and complete required training within specified timelines.
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ities
  • Completion of Illinois 40-hour armed course with pistol endorsement.
  • Willingness to carry and maintain department-issued firearm and holster.
  • Strong judgment, communication skills, and ability to handle stressful and physically demanding situations.
Physical Requirements and Working Conditions
  • Ability to sit, stand, walk, drive, lift up to 35 lbs., and operate firearms safely.
  • Corrected 20/20 vision, exposure to hazards, and handling emotionally charged situations.

This role requires adherence to safety protocols and the ability to respond effectively in emergencies. The incumbent may be required to perform other related duties as necessary.
